Method for Cultivating a Vegetable worms Having a Function of a Natural Preserved Agent and a Freshness Keeping Agent and an Extract from the Same and a Natural Complex Composition From the Same
The present invention relates to a method for cultivating vegetable worms having a function of a natural preserved agent and freshness keeping agent. The method comprises obtaining a mycelium by inoculating a cordyceps militaris or a cordyceps nutans to a liquid medium, a solid medium or a worm body; and forming a fruit body from the mycelium by cultivating a solid medium or a worm body.
Ethical Tissues for Transplantation
The present disclosure relates to organisms genetically engineered to have reduced higher brain structures, tissues obtained from such organisms, and methods of making such organisms for the purpose of supplying cruelty free tissues and organs from organisms with severely reduced ability to suffer or completely lack the ability to experience suffering.
TRANSGENIC PIG ISLETS AND USES THEREOF FOR TREATING DIABETES
The present invention relates to an isolated transgenic pig beta cell wherein the PKC and the PKA pathway are constitutively activated; to a transgenic pig islet comprising said transgenic pig beta cell; and to a transgenic pig comprising said transgenic pig beta cell or said transgenic pig islet. Another object of the invention is a device comprising a transgenic pig beta cell or a transgenic pig islet of the invention. The present invention also relates to the use of said transgenic pig beta cell, said transgenic pig islet, or said device for treating a disease, disorder or condition related to the impaired function of endocrine pancreas or of beta cell.
HIGH-WEIGHT BLACK SOLDIER FLY LARVAE, METHODS OF PRODUCING SAME AND USE THEREOF
The present invention relates to larvae of black soldier fly having high weight, to methods of producing same and to use of the high weight larvae in various applications including as a food or feed, as a source for food grade ingredients including proteins, chitin, and fat, and for conversion of waste into biomass.
